from Standing in the Shadow

to believe
winds that blow, do coldly,
set loose this soul's unease.
a heart that ventured boldly,
now loneliness must appease.

for why in shelter even sought
this heart a comfort from the wind?
crushed so carelessly without a thought,
man has fallen, love has sinned.

still stands fast this simple man,
with discipline and trust.
for courage wavers without plan
and believing is a must.

tomorrow is but another day,
brought by night to end.
if then love should come my way,
it will be brought,
by you,
my friend.

written by Shadow, for me, shortly after we met
